Yes, I understand the mechanism of fragmentation, but you haven't mentioned the other side of the coin - the creation and growth of a national identity in the first place. It does not happen automatically either.
This is generally accepted, I think, as arising from great transformative events that result in a majority of the population sharing certain experiences: a religious uprising, war, migration and disaster. What arises then are shared values and cohesion.
When I was growing up, a high proportion of the population had the shared experience of WWII and to a lesser extent WWI. There were a lot of shared values which permeated society. Not so today.
Another good example is Germany - before say, 1870, Germany was a patchwork of principalities, many of which were a byword for laziness, backwardness and corruption. Yet 65 years later it becomes a monolith, single minded, intelligent and capable.

My viewpoint is that identity politics including the left-right frame are primarily meant to divide and distract those on the losing end of the power deal.
My economic research leads me to conclude that the shift began decades ago towards more concentration and financializiation of the economy. It really began accelerating during the Reagan presidency and went into over-drive with full thrusters since the Bill Clinton administration when Wall St completely took over both the executive and legislative branches. The Trump administration did not apply any brakes either.
In this context Judith Stein's book "Pivotal Decade - How the United States traded factories for finance in the seventies" is well worth a read.
https://twitter.com/michaelxpettis/status/1359506447999115267?s=20
This transition to "finance capitalism" and now unprecedented economic concentration which has led to capture of the political, governmental & judicial system was aided and abetted by both the "left" and the "right". Yes, the "socialists" and "conservatives".
This interview of finance capitalist Sir James Goldsmith and his debate with Clinton's chief economic advisor is so important, because there were critical voices in the 90s who rang the bell against the sellout. Yet the majority of the "left" and "right" supported the sellout.
https://youtu.be/wwmOkaKh3-s
The Party of Davos have ramped up the "culture wars" precisely to prevent a reckoning of their unprecedented, at least in US terms, power grab. IMO, as long as the majority of the "losers" in this power war are distracted by identity and culture they will be unable to fight & overcome this extraordinary concentration of power. While today it appears the Maoist tendencies as Barbara Ann notes are directed towards "white supremacists" and "racists", we can be certain the pendulum will also swing and target other "identities" nominally associated with the "left" as that is precisely how authoritarians keep the "losing" populace from unifying against the common enemy.
